PURPOSE: An anode for a lithium-sulfur battery is provided to suppress the flow out of a polysulfide which is a charging/discharging intermediate product of the anode active material into an electrolyte according to introduction of an anion immobilization materials in the lithium-sulfur anode thereby the capacity retention rate of the lithium-sulfur battery is improved. CONSTITUTION: An anode for a lithium-sulfur battery comprises the followings: elemental sulfur (S8); anode active material which comprises sulfur series compound and a mixture thereof; a conductive material; a binder, and an anion immobilization material. A content of the anion immobilization material is 0.5-50 weight%; an average size of a particle of the anion immobilization material is 0.01-10 micron. The conductive material is selected from a group which comprises a graphite material, a carbon-based material and conductivity polymer. In addition, the lithium-sulfur battery comprises an anode, a cathode, a separator which is interposed between anode and cathode, and electrolyte.
